  John Cody
  Copiopteryx semiramis female / © 2007
  transparent watercolor on Arches 300lb cold press
30"w x 22"h
  Purpose: Public awareness-to augment visual records of Saturnid moths.

This is No., 142 in the series of large moth paintings Dr. Cody has done since his retirement from psychiatric practice in 1986. Those completed earlier are regrettably dispersed; those since are preserved as a collection for increasing public awareness. Initially - as long ago as his high school days - his work was motivated solely by aesthetic pleasure in the beauty of the giant (Saturniid) silk moths. In recent decades he has been spurred to greater creative effort because moth populations are diminishing world wide for the usual reasons (habitat destruction and disruption) some species verging on extinction.
